External Validity
The extent to which the results of a study can be generalized to other situations and to other people.
Internal Validity
The extent to which a study can demonstrate that a causal relationship exists between variables, free from external influences.
Construct Validity
The extent to which a test measures what it claims to be measuring, in the context of psychological testing and research.
Mundane Realism
Refers to whether the setting of an experiment physically resembles the real world.
